What Are Freestyle Trap Beats?

To be conscious of the importance of freestyle trap beats, it's essential to first break down what a freestyle beat in fact is. In easy terms, a freestyle beat is an crucial track that is developed for artists to rap or sing over without the demand for pre-written lyrics or tunes. It's suggested to influence off-the-cuff efficiencies, urging rap artists to provide spontaneous and commonly much more raw, psychological verses.

A freestyle type beat differs slightly from a regular instrumental because it's structured in a way that offers artists area to breathe. These beats usually have less melodic elements, leaving room for detailed flows and powerful wordplay. They're also commonly much more recurring than typical track instrumentals, making certain that the rapper or vocalist can conveniently discover their groove and ride the beat without getting lost in complicated arrangements.

Freestyle Trap Beats A Subgenre Within Freestyle

Now, within the dimension of freestyle beats, there is a certain subset referred to as freestyle trap beat. Trap music, originating from the southern United States, is characterized by heavy use 808 bass drums, fast hi-hat patterns, and dark, irritable tunes. It's a sound that has grown in popularity for many years, becoming one of one of the most prominent styles in modern-day rap.

Freestyle trap beats take these trademark components and fuse them with the freedom and flexibility of freestyle beats, causing a strong fusion. These beats are ideal for musicians aiming to bring energy and hostility to their verses while still keeping the liberty to discover different flows and designs.

What Is a Free Type Beat?

A free type beat is an instrumental that music producers give completely free usage, usually for non-commercial purposes. While the beats can be made use of for trials, freestyles, and social media sites content, artists usually need to invest in a license if they wish to release the track readily (i.e., on streaming systems or up for sale).

This version has actually been a game-changer, permitting young artists to trying out their sound, practice their freestyling, and develop an internet-based visibility without needing to fret about production costs.

Just how to Choose the Perfect Freestyle Trap Beat.

With so many opportunities offered, choosing the best ** freestyle trap beat ** can really feel frustrating. Below are some key aspects to think about when looking for the ideal beat:.

1. Tempo.

The Bpm (Beats per Minute) of a beat will determine the total feel of your freestyle. Freestyle type beats with quick paces are perfect for high-energy performances, while slower tempos give you more area to check out various flows and lyrical motifs. Consider your style and exactly how comfortable you are freestyling at different speeds before picking a beat.

2. Intricacy.

Some beats are a lot more complex than others, including a broad array of sounds, melodies, and shifts. While intricate beats can include exhilaration to a track, they could likewise make it harder to freestyle over. Less complex freestyle beats are frequently much easier to collaborate with, as they supply a empty canvas for your verses.

3. Mood and Vibe.

The feeling of the beat need to match the message or power you intend to share. Freestyle trap beats typically have dark, moody touches, but there are additionally more uplifting or melodic alternatives offered. Listen to a selection of beats and select one that reverberates with your imaginative vision.

4. Familiarity with the Sound.

Certain types of beats, like the DaBaby type beat, are designed to accommodate certain flows and rap designs. If you're comfortable rapping over quick, hard-hitting instrumentals, this could be the best option for you.
